About the Role
Build your career delivering critical defence infrastructure.
At Babcock, we’re working to create a safe and secure world, together. If you join us, you can play your part as an Assistant Project Manager at our Devonport Royal Dockyard site.
The Role
As an Assistant Project Manager, you’ll support the delivery of civil engineering work packages for one of the UK’s most significant infrastructure programmes, supporting naval operations.
Daily responsibilities include:
- Working alongside experienced Project and Package Managers to coordinate planning, cost, scheduling, and risk activities.
- This is an opportunity to build your project management career in a highly regulated environment, gaining exposure to complex defence engineering projects.
Key Duties
- Supporting the delivery of civil engineering work packages across the entire programme.
- Coordinating project activities, including:
- Planning
- Cost tracking
- Scheduling
- Assisting in defining project scope, requirements, and delivery solutions.
- Managing and supporting risk and issue processes across work packages.
- Engaging with stakeholders and supporting communication and reporting activities.

This role is based on-site at Devonport Royal Dockyard and operates 35 hours per week on a full-time basis.
Essential Experience & Qualifications
Experience Requirements
Experience working within a project delivery or technical environment, including:
- Understanding of project controls (e.g., planning, cost monitoring, and reporting).
- Knowledge of civil engineering or construction management principles.
- Experience supporting risk management and stakeholder coordination.
- Strong organisational and communication skills.
Qualifications
- ONC or OND in civil engineering, construction management, or a related discipline.
- Desirable:
- Training in risk assessment or health and safety.
- Familiarity with NEC contracts or project management systems.
Security Clearance
The successful candidate must be able to achieve and maintain a Security Check (SC) clearance.
